A片 No Further a Mystery

To state that just one approach is bad without the need of supplying another just isn't really productive. I'm often seeking strategies to enhance and when there is an alternate I'll gladly investigate it and weigh the professional's and cons.

Though The solution from Niklas B. is very thorough, when we wish to find an product in an inventory it is usually practical to receive its index:

If you intend to do some thing with the file, I might advise directly attempting it by using a test-apart from in order to avoid a race issue:

Retail store this benefit to x Any thread is often at any move in this process Anytime, and they are able to stage on each other whenever a shared source is involved. The state of x can be improved by An additional thread in the time among x is becoming read through and when it can be published again.

Now the above might be the most effective pragmatic direct remedy below, but you can find the potential for a race issue (dependant upon Whatever you're attempting to perform), and The reality that the fundamental implementation works by using a try out, but Python makes use of try everywhere in its implementation.

How to make and run a Digital atmosphere for my Python plans in VS Code ? I want a number of selected programms to run inside a separate surroundings 293

The lock may well use the system termed Semaphore or Mutex. In the meantime other process that ought to utilize the shared resource will do the identical methods.

So race ailment in software package field usually means "two threads"/"two processes" racing one another to "affect some shared point out", and the final result of the shared condition will depend upon some delicate timing variation, which may be caused by some unique thread/course of action launching purchase, thread/procedure scheduling, and so on.

This is certainly The best way to examine if a file exists. Just because the file existed whenever you checked doesn't assure that it'll be there when you should open it.

route.isdir or os.route.lexist as it's a website bunch of Python amount purpose calls and string operations prior to it decides the effective route is feasible, but no extra process phone or I/O function, that is orders of magnitude slower).

Resources for stopping race circumstances are dependent on the language and OS, but some comon types are mutexes, essential sections, and indicators. Mutexes are very good when you want to be sure to're the only real just one doing a little something.

Business enterprise specialized issues bring on unsuccessful payment becoming thought of productive. Do I've any duty to inform?

Due to the fact Python employs check out in all places, you will find genuinely no explanation to prevent an implementation that works by using it.

When you have a necessities.txt file you want to employ to install deals, you are able to specify it in this article. The virtual ecosystem are going click here to be designed according to the deals mentioned In this particular file. Otherwise, it is possible to depart this option blank.

Leave a Reply

Your email address will not be published. Required fields are marked *